Apply today!What You Will Do💡
  • Coordinate and manage relationships with third-party logistics providers to ensure optimal service delivery.
  • Monitor logistics operations, including transportation, warehousing, and distribution activities.
  • Evaluate and optimize logistics processes to drive efficiency and reduce costs.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to align supply chain processes with market demands.
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, regulations, and safety standards.
  • Prepare and present reports on logistics performance, issues, and improvement opportunities.
  • Identify potential challenges and implement proactive strategies to mitigate risks.
  • Maintain accurate documentation of logistics activities and vendor agreements.
  • Act as a point of contact for any logistics-related inquiries and problem resolution
RequirementsWhat Are We Looking For❓
  • Bachelor's deg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, or a related field.
  • 2-3 years of experience in logistics and supply chain management, preferably with third-party logistics providers.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, ever-evolving environment.
  • Proficient in logistics software and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el.
  • Detail-oriented with a focus on accuracy and efficiency.
  • Familiarity with industry regulations and compliance standards
